The Lakewood Tigers will face off against the Chatfield Chargers at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Lakewood is coming into the match on a three-game losing streak.
It was a proper cat-fight when Lakewood challenged Arvada West on Saturday. Lakewood was beaten by Arvada West 65-23. While losing is never fun, the Tigers can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Colorado basketball rankings (they are ranked 163rd, while the Wildcats are ranked 16th).

Despite the loss, Lakewood saw an underclassman step up: sophomore Iben Last posted 13 points and five blocks. Last has become a key player for Lakewood: the team is 2-1 when she posts at least three blocks, but 3-13 otherwise.
Meanwhile, Chatfield hadn't done well against Ralston Valley recently (they were 1-8 in their previous nine mat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Saturday. Chatfield walked away with a 52-45 win over Ralston Valley.
Chatfield's victory bumped their record up to 7-11. As for Lakewood, their defeat dropped their record down to 5-14.
Lakewood suffered a grim 69-45 defeat to Chatfield in their previous meeting back in January. A big factor in that loss was the dominant performance of Chatfield's Sadie Goodwin, who dropped a double-double on 25 points and ten rebounds.
